Data Engineer
2 days ago
Join to apply for the Data Engineer (Data Migrations) role at TieTalent2 days ago Be among the first 25 applicantsJoin to apply for the Data Engineer (Data Migrations) role at TieTalentGet AI-powered advice on this job and more exclusive features.AboutData Engineer (Data Migrations)Remote | Full-time | UK Timezones (UTC-4 to UTC+3 preferred) About Carebit Carebit is a design-led, remote-first healthtech company helping hundreds of private doctors across the UK run their practices more efficiently—and delivering a better experience for their patients. We’re profitable, bootstrapped, and committed to staying remote. We doubled revenue in 2024 and continue to grow at a rapid pace. With a growing queue of new practices ready to migrate, we’re hiring a Data Engineer to own and deliver migrations from start to finish, and improve our robust Ruby data tooling. The role You’ll guide new customers through migrating from their old practice management systems into Carebit. This involves cleaning, validating, and converting data (patients, bookings, invoices, etc.)—usually from structured exports or spreadsheets. You’ll communicate with customers throughout the process, helping them feel confident and supported. All key processes are well documented in our internal playbook. A typical migration includes: Booking a migration date and answering any customer queries Receiving data via FTP (typically ~5GB) Cleaning, validating, and converting data using Ruby scripts (CSV → JSON) Writing new Ruby scripts where needed (for less structured sources) Uploading converted data to AWS S3 and scheduling import jobs Iterating on our tooling and processes to improve speed, reliability, and test coverage You’ll work alongside experienced Ruby and DevOps engineers, including the original author of our migration tooling. Requirements Proven experience as a Data Engineer or backend developer with strong data transformation and scripting skills Proficiency in Ruby (or ability to pick it up quickly); experience processing CSV and outputting JSON Comfortable with Linux, bash scripting, Ansible provisioning, and remote Ubuntu environments Familiar with both SQL and NoSQL structures (e.g. we import from MongoDB, though don’t use it internally) Experience validating, transforming, and cleaning large datasets Confident working with CSV/JSON, Postgres (for intermediate processing), and AWS S3 Experience building automated test suites (we use RSpec) Excellent spoken/written English, customer-focused mindset, and calm communication style Able to own and improve a technical function independently Located within UTC-4 to UTC+3 (UTC+1 preferred for alignment) Bonus points for Formal ETL experience AWS and Terraform knowledge An automation-first mindset Benefits Competitive salary 25 days holiday/year Async work culture with minimal meetings Laptop, chair, and setup budgetAboutData Engineer (Data Migrations)Remote | Full-time | UK Timezones (UTC-4 to UTC+3 preferred) About Carebit Carebit is a design-led, remote-first healthtech company helping hundreds of private doctors across the UK run their practices more efficiently—and delivering a better experience for their patients. We’re profitable, bootstrapped, and committed to staying remote. We doubled revenue in 2024 and continue to grow at a rapid pace. With a growing queue of new practices ready to migrate, we’re hiring a Data Engineer to own and deliver migrations from start to finish, and improve our robust Ruby data tooling. The role You’ll guide new customers through migrating from their old practice management systems into Carebit. This involves cleaning, validating, and converting data (patients, bookings, invoices, etc.)—usually from structured exports or spreadsheets. You’ll communicate with customers throughout the process, helping them feel confident and supported. All key processes are well documented in our internal playbook. A typical migration includes: Booking a migration date and answering any customer queries Receiving data via FTP (typically ~5GB) Cleaning, validating, and converting data using Ruby scripts (CSV → JSON) Writing new Ruby scripts where needed (for less structured sources) Uploading converted data to AWS S3 and scheduling import jobs Iterating on our tooling and processes to improve speed, reliability, and test coverage You’ll work alongside experienced Ruby and DevOps engineers, including the original author of our migration tooling. Requirements Proven experience as a Data Engineer or backend developer with strong data transformation and scripting skills Proficiency in Ruby (or ability to pick it up quickly); experience processing CSV and outputting JSON Comfortable with Linux, bash scripting, Ansible provisioning, and remote Ubuntu environments Familiar with both SQL and NoSQL structures (e.g. we import from MongoDB, though don’t use it internally) Experience validating, transforming, and cleaning large datasets Confident working with CSV/JSON, Postgres (for intermediate processing), and AWS S3 Experience building automated test suites (we use RSpec) Excellent spoken/written English, customer-focused mindset, and calm communication style Able to own and improve a technical function independently Located within UTC-4 to UTC+3 (UTC+1 preferred for alignment) Bonus points for Formal ETL experience AWS and Terraform knowledge An automation-first mindset Benefits Competitive salary 25 days holiday/year Async work culture with minimal meetings Laptop, chair, and setup budgetNice-to-have skillsAnsibleLinuxMongoDBNoSQLRubySQLUbuntuLondon, England, United KingdomWork experienceData EngineerData InfrastructureLanguagesEnglishSeniority levelSeniority levelMid-Senior levelEmployment typeEmployment typeFull-timeJob functionJob functionInformation TechnologyIndustriesTechnology, Information and InternetReferrals increase your chances of interviewing at TieTalent by 2xGet notified about new Data Engineer jobs in London, England, United Kingdom.London, England, United Kingdom 2 weeks agoLondon, England, United Kingdom 1 week agoLondon, England, United Kingdom 3 weeks agoLondon, England, United Kingdom 1 week agoLondon Area, United Kingdom $150,000.00-$200,000.00 3 weeks agoLondon, England, United Kingdom 2 days agoLondon, England, United Kingdom 1 week agoLondon, England, United Kingdom 3 weeks agoGreater London, England, United Kingdom 2 months agoLondon, England, United Kingdom 2 weeks agoLondon, England, United Kingdom 3 days agoLondon, England, United Kingdom 1 week agoLondon, England, United Kingdom 1 week agoLondon, England, United Kingdom 5 months agoLondon, England, United Kingdom 3 days agoLondon, England, United Kingdom 1 month agoLondon, England, United Kingdom 1 month agoLondon, England, United Kingdom 1 week agoLondon, England, United Kingdom 1 month agoLondon, England, United Kingdom £60,000.00-£80,000.00 1 month agoLondon, England, United Kingdom 2 days agoLondon, England, United Kingdom 1 month agoLondon, England, United Kingdom 1 month agoLondon, England, United Kingdom 2 weeks agoGraduate Software Engineer (Data & Infrastructure)London, England, United Kingdom 3 months agoLondon, England, United Kingdom 1 month agoLondon, England, United Kingdom 2 weeks agoLondon, England, United Kingdom 1 week agoLondon, England, United Kingdom 3 weeks agoLondon, England, United Kingdom 5 days agoWe’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I. #J-18808-Ljbffr
-
Data Engineer
2 weeks ago
London, United Kingdom Data Idols Full time**Data Engineer** Would you like to build enterprise scale data solutions for a global organisation that reaches 400 million users monthly? We are supporting an ambitious data-driven client in the world of Multimedia with their search for a Data Engineer to develop and maintainnew features of their data platform and end-to-end delivery of exciting data...
-
Data Engineer
5 days ago
London, Greater London, United Kingdom Data Idols Full timeData EngineerSalary: £80,00 - £85,000Location: Hybrid - London - 1 day per weekWe are currently looking for a Data Engineer to join our client's forward-thinking, collaborative, and technology-driven team. In this role, you'll take the lead in shaping and delivering modern cloud data solutions, working closely with a highly skilled Data & BI function....
-
Data Engineer
1 week ago
London, United Kingdom Data Idols Full time**Data Engineer** Data Idols are excited to be working with one of the top 100 companies in the world to recruit a Data Engineer! A company which owns multiple brands and who are investing heavily into 'all things data' to revolutionise their extraordinary team. **Skills and Experience**: - Experience with Azure - Experience with SQL - Experience with...
-
Data Engineer
2 weeks ago
London, United Kingdom Data Idols Full time**Data Engineer** Data Idols are proud to be working with a growing veterinary business who are extremely data driven and have a great mission to use data to improve the welfare of animals. They have a revolutionary data team who want to be recognised as the UK's leadingveterinary group and are home to some of the best clinicians world-wide; would you like...
-
Data Engineer
6 days ago
London, United Kingdom Data Idols Full time**Data Engineer** Data Idols are proud to be working with a leading technology and engineering consultancy who have been running for decades globally. They work with a variety of clients across different industries on their biggest challenges. Would you like to work alongsidethis company, where you get the chance to work across a wide range of tools, tech,...
-
Data Engineer
2 weeks ago
London, United Kingdom Data Idols Full time**Data Engineer** Are you a contractor seeking a new project where you take ownership of Data Science, ETL pipelines, warehouses and everything else analytics, within an alternative and refreshing industry? Our client are a global fashion marketplace, with a mission to praisecreativity, connect consumers to unique and sustainable products, and support...
-
Data Engineer
6 days ago
Greater London, United Kingdom Data Idols Full timeBase Pay RangeSalary: £80,000 - £85,000Location: Hybrid - London - 1 day per weekOverviewWe are currently looking for a Data Engineer to join our client's forward-thinking, collaborative, and technology-driven team. In this role, you'll take the lead in shaping and delivering modern cloud data solutions, working closely with a highly skilled Data & BI...
-
Data Engineer
14 hours ago
Greater London, United Kingdom Data Idols Full timeBase pay range Salary: £80,000 - £85,000 Location: Hybrid - London - 1 day per week We are currently looking for a Data Engineer to join our client's forward-thinking, collaborative, and technology-driven team. In this role, you'll take the lead in shaping and delivering modern cloud data solutions, working closely with a highly skilled Data & BI function....
-
Lead Data Engineer
3 days ago
London, United Kingdom Data Idols Full time**Lead Data Engineer** Are you a Senior or Lead Data Engineer, or perhaps a Data Engineer with more than 4 years experience wanting to up your leadership abilities, and looking for involvement within a nice mix both BAU and greenfield projects? Data Idols are working with a well-known retail company whose brands are certainly well known to households in the...
-
Data Engineering Manager
4 days ago
London, United Kingdom Data Idols Full time**Data Engineering Manager** Data Idols are proud to be working with an iconic UK brand to assist them in hiring a Data Engineering Manager as they undertake a digital and data-driven journey that will transform the business. Data is at the heart of the organisation and forms a keypart of their future plans. **The Opportunity** As a Data Engineering...